Njomza is a multifaceted artist who has significantly impacted the music industry. She has evolved from a talented songwriter to a Grammy-nominated artist, collaborating with big names such as Ariana Grande and Skrillex. Her solo career took off with the release of her 2017 EP "Sad For You," while her behind-the-scenes work, including co-writing Ariana Grande's "7 Rings" and "Thank U, Next," earned her two Grammy nominations.
Njomza's music transcends genres, drawing from pop, R&B, and electronic influences. She describes her creative process as raw and vulnerable, focusing on conveying genuine emotion. Whether delving into themes of love, heartbreak, or personal growth, her music fosters a deep connection with her audience.
